Output 589879f7f6cbfb13e28377887529121180aa4aa30c83a60e1ee58a429d3b9a6c:1

value
476705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f04f611bec9c68b21ef9e8971da92d16e64df8f0 OP_EQUAL
address
3PbfBxPRDr6ygszHuUPNJiWZAZ5DC6EXRM
transaction
589879f7f6cbfb13e28377887529121180aa4aa30c83a60e1ee58a429d3b9a6c
spent
true